What it's actually like to stay here

Quiet and green, built for slowing down rather than going out — most lodges here are largely self-contained, with their own restaurant, pool, and grounds, and evenings are typically spent on-site rather than in town. Birdsong and cicadas replace traffic noise, and several properties run their own guided night walks through the reserve.

Stay here if

Best for couples and families who want a resort-style, nature-immersed stay and don't mind a short drive into town for variety, and for travelers prioritizing a quiet jungle setting over walkable restaurants and nightlife.

Stay elsewhere if

Consider Centro instead if you'd rather walk to a range of restaurants each night or want to save on transport — dining here mostly means eating at your hotel or arranging a taxi into town and back.

Walkability
Not walkable in the town-center sense — there's no cluster of shops or restaurants to walk between, though most lodges have their own jungle trails on-site, and some offer guided walks through the wider Selva Iryapú reserve.
Noise at night
Very quiet — this is the quietest lodging option in Puerto Iguazú, with jungle sounds rather than street or traffic noise.

Transportation & practical information

Selva Iryapú sits a few kilometers off downtown Puerto Iguazú, roughly a 10–15 minute drive depending on the exact lodge and traffic near the border-crossing area — hotels here typically arrange taxis or shuttles for guests, both into town and onward to the national park entrance, which is a further 15–20 minutes or so down the same road.

Not essential — every lodge here can arrange transport into town or to the park — but useful if you want the flexibility to come and go without waiting on a hotel shuttle or calling a taxi each time.

How far is Selva Iryapú from Iguazú Falls?
Roughly 15–20 minutes further down the same road that connects it to downtown Puerto Iguazú, though exact drive times vary by lodge — most properties can arrange transport to the park entrance.
